When people buy tablets they don’t necessarily use them to read. Simba Information, a marketing intelligence company, reports that half of iPad owners and 25 percent of Kindle Fire owners didn’t read a single e-book last year. “E-books sound really cool if you’re a publisher in a room with smart tech people,” Michael Norris, a senior analyst at Simba Information says. “Everyone just assumed that when people had tablets, they’ll become readers. That’s nonsense.”
